The checklist says to include 2 return shipping labels. I'm currently in US and wants to send my initial set of docs to CIO Sydney. My chosen consulate center is New Delhi, India since I havent been in US for more than 1 year.

My questions are
1. Can I use Fedex shipping labels printed online?
2. Do I need to include envelope too or just shipping labels to my home address?
3. What should I put in the FROM address of the shipping label? CIO sydney or New Delhi consulate?

Please advice

thanks
 
Looks like you're making simple things too complicated, friend. ;)

Checklist says that you need to enclose 2 self-address mailing labels. Which means that you should provide them with your own residential address only. So that they can put in on the envelope if the package needs to be send back. The rest CIO itself will take care of.
